Crafts Council in Conversation with TOAST Artist in Residence

23 October


Crafts Council Gallery, Islington

£10 - £15

Book tickets

  • TOAST Creative Residency

In collaboration with the Crafts Council, sustainable fashion and lifestyle brand TOAST present the TOAST Creative Residency. As part of this year's programme, join the Crafts Council in conversation with TOAST's chosen artist, as they reveal work inspired by the 'Rewilding' seasonal collection.

During this talk and presentation, curator of creative partnerships and programmes Annabelle Campbell will be in conversation with the artist (to be announced), and will share their innovative way of working, guiding us through their creative process.

The open call sought artists from a variety of backgrounds and creative disciplines to submit artwork exploring the seasonal theme of Rewilding. The selected artist will present their work at the Creative Residency, be profiled within Crafts Magazine and later be donated to the Crafts Council collection.

TOAST Creative Residency

This year's residency is a three-day blended programme of engaging talks, workshops and live demonstrations hosted both online and in-person at the Crafts Council Gallery in Islington. Events are open to all and attendees will explore repurposing, reinventing and reuse of materials.

20% of all ticket sales will be donated by TOAST to the Crafts Council's Young Craft Citizens programme - offering workshops, paid opportunities and creative and professional advice for young people from all backgrounds interested in shaping the future of craft, design and making in the UK.

About TOAST

TOAST began with loungewear and nightwear, designed in a farmhouse in Wales. Originally founded by James and Jessica Seaton in 1997, the collections reflected a sense of ease and a slower, more thoughtful way of life. Today, led by Suzie de Rohan Willner, TOAST creates and curates simple, functional, beautiful clothing, homeware and editorial.

TOAST has shops throughout the UK and can be found in concept stores across the US and Europe. With studios in both London and Swansea, TOAST continues to design and develop all collections in-house and is proud to be one of the few fashion brands with its own full pattern room – lined with calico toiles and full of pins, papers, chalks and spools of thread, it is a true place of making.
